"The Seahawks have a bye this weekend, the players given four days off before returning on Monday.

That doesn't mean the team is idle, though. Not with the Seahawks being one of the most active teams in the league in terms of roster moves.

One possibility to keep an eye on is that wide receiver Deion Branch would be traded to New England, the team from whom Seattle acquired him in 2006.

It's premature to say a trade is on the table, but discussions had taken place as of Wednesday night. By Thursday, the possibility of a deal was mentioned both in Seattle and in New England.

The Patriots traded Randy Moss to Minnesota earlier this week. Branch remains a local favorite in Boston, and quarterback Tom Brady is especially fond of him."
